Lifting Gear Hire (LGH) has hired Larry Parnacott as a national account representative.
Parnacott’s work background focuses on power plants, steel mills and shipyards, bringing to LGH with more than 20 years of experience in the rental industry, having most recently worked as an account representative for Delta Rigging.
His new duties at LGH will include maintaining the company’s current national account, looking for new opportunities in national accounts, and staying on top of market conditions regarding products.
